dbForge Studio for MySQL is a universal GUI tool for MySQL and MariaDB database development, management, and administration.
It is a full-fledged IDE that helps create and execute queries, develop and debug stored routines, automates database object management, compares and synchronize databases, analyzes table data, and much more. Its rich functionality is delivered under an intuitive interface.
In addition, dbForge Studio for MySQL is a perfect alternative to MySQL Workbench for those who are looking for a broader set of features and improved performance.

dbForge Studio for MySQL stands out for its user-friendly interface, making database management and development simpler, especially with its stellar SQL editor that supports code completion and neat formatting. It shines with database comparison and synchronization, ideal for developers dealing with complex updates. Integrating version control systems through its source control feature is particularly beneficial for team environments, offering efficient change tracking and management. It's a robust tool for developers needing to handle frequent schema updates.
It can be demanding on older hardware and has a learning curve for advanced features.

Extensive support for MySQL-specific features, including stored procedures, triggers, and events; seamless integration with version control systems like Git in the newly released v10; and reliable data and schema comparison and sync functionality supporting CLI automation.
Occasional slowdowns during processing big volumes of data may occur, particularly when executing resource-intensive operations such as complex queries or large-scale data migrations.
